5 Factors to Consider When Choosing a Career

choosing a career


Choosing a career is one of the most important decisions a person can make in their life. It is a decision that will shape their future, and determine their financial stability and overall happiness. In South Africa, there are several factors to consider when choosing a career that is unique to the country’s social, economic, and political landscape. In this article, we will explore five of these factors that should be considered when choosing a career in South Africa.

1. Job Market

The job market in South Africa is highly competitive, and certain industries have a higher demand for skilled workers than others. It is essential to research the current job market trends and understand which industries are thriving and which are struggling. This knowledge will help in identifying career options that are in high demand and have growth potential. For example, healthcare, finance, and IT are currently in high demand in South Africa, while traditional sectors such as manufacturing and agriculture are facing challenges.

2. Education and Skills

Education and skills are crucial factors when choosing a career in South Africa. With the high level of competition in the job market, having a good education and marketable skills is essential. Consider the level of education required for the career of interest, as well as the training and certification required. It is also important to determine the availability of education and training programs in the area of interest.

3. Cultural and Social Factors

South Africa is a culturally diverse country with 11 official languages and a rich history. Cultural and social factors such as race, gender, and ethnicity can impact career options and opportunities. It is essential to research the work environment and cultural norms of the industry of interest to ensure that it aligns with one’s values and beliefs. For example, some industries may have cultural barriers or biases that can impact career growth and advancement.

4. Economic Factors

The economic climate in South Africa can have a significant impact on career choices. The country has high levels of unemployment and income inequality, which can limit opportunities in certain industries. It is important to research the average salary for the chosen career and assess whether it can provide financial stability and growth. It is also important to consider the potential for career growth and advancement within the industry.

5. Personal Interests and Passion

Personal interests and passion are essential factors to consider when choosing a career in South Africa. Pursuing a career that aligns with one’s interests and passions can lead to greater job satisfaction and a fulfilling career. It is important to take time to identify one’s strengths, interests, and values and align them with career options. This process can involve job shadowing, internships, and informational interviews to gain a deeper understanding of the industry.

In conclusion, choosing a career in South Africa requires careful consideration of several unique factors. Understanding the job market, education and skills, cultural and social factors, economic factors, and personal interests and passion can help in making an informed decision. By taking the time to research and evaluate these factors, individuals can choose a career that aligns with their goals, values, and personal interests, and ultimately lead to a fulfilling career in South Africa.
